How they compare

Montenegro currently reports 20.0% against 19.7% in Serbia, a difference of 0.3%.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 17 shared years of data; in 2006 it was Montenegro ahead.

Montenegro ranks 30th and Serbia ranks 31st of 70 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Montenegro averaged higher in 2 and Serbia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Montenegro Serbia Difference Ahead
2000s 7.8% 7.2% 0.6% Montenegro
2010s 22.1% 23.0% 0.9% Serbia
2020s 20.4% 20.3% 0.1% Montenegro

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

National poverty headcount ratio is the percentage of the population living below the national poverty lines. National estimates are based on population-weighted subgroup estimates from household surveys.
